Technology Ecosystem Fund (TEF)

Administered by Deputy Mayor for Planning and Economic Development (DMPED) · District of Columbia

BENEFIT
Negotiated / contact agency
Deadline type: annual

Eligibility Requirements

  • 1Organizations supporting creation, incubation, acceleration of technology companies
  • 2Projects with direct or indirect effect on DC's technology ecosystem
  • 3Support services to companies and entrepreneurial ecosystem intermediaries
